About

Bryn Carmel is a named summit in wales-north, United Kingdom, with an elevation of approximately 116 metres. Listed in the Wikidata register of UK peaks; see the Wikipedia article for further details on the mountain's location, geology and walking routes.

Llechgynfarwy

Llechgynfarwy (or Llechcynfarwy) is a village in the community of Tref Alaw, Anglesey, Wales. It is the location of St Cynfarwy's Church.
